Orthodontics for adults involves specialized treatments to correct misaligned / crooked teeth in adulthood. At our modern dentistry practice in Leipzig, we primarily use modern aligner systems—transparent, removable dental splints that are virtually invisible. Unlike conventional fixed braces, aligners are much more comfortable to wear and are more aesthetically pleasing. To achieve optimal results, small tooth-colored attachments are temporarily bonded to the teeth as needed to improve the effectiveness of the invisible braces. We only resort to fixed brackets in cases of very severe malocclusion or in combination with jaw surgery. In these cases, we exclusively use modern, self-ligating ceramic brackets, which are planned using CAD/CAM technology and precisely placed using the indirect bonding method.
The decision to undergo orthodontics for adults in Leipzig can have various causes: Aesthetic reasons: A harmonious smile not only increases attractiveness, but also self-confidence.
Functional problems: Misalignments can lead to problems with chewing, speaking, or overloading individual teeth.
Periodontal health: Straight teeth are easier to clean, which reduces the risk of tooth gum diseases.
Temporomandibular joint problems: Malocclusion can lead to pain in the temporomandibular joint, headaches, or neck tension.
Follow-up treatment from childhood: Some adults require further treatment because their teeth have shifted again after previous treatment.
Pre-treatment for prosthetic dentures: Orthodontic pre-treatment may be necessary before crowns, bridges, or implants can be made.
The cost of orthodontics for adults at our practice in Leipzig varies depending on the treatment method, the severity of the misalignment, and the duration of treatment. The price for invisible braces for adults ranges from €4,000 to €8,000. Statutory health insurance companies usually only cover the costs for adults in medically necessary cases with severe misalignments. Private health insurance companies often offer better reimbursement options, depending on the individual tariff. We will draw up an individual cost plan after the initial examination.

Treatment begins with a comprehensive diagnosis, during which Dr. Niels Hoffmann conducts a thorough examination of your tooth and jaw. X-rays, 3D scans, and impressions enable a precise analysis. Based on these results, we create an individual treatment plan. For aligner treatment, digital impressions of your teeth are taken, which serve as the basis for computer-assisted planning and visualize the course of treatment.
With aligner treatment, you receive a series of transparent dental splints that you change every one to two weeks. Each aligner gradually moves your teeth into the desired position and should be worn for 20-22 hours a day. Instead of extracting teeth to create space, our practice uses the gentle ASR (approximal tooth reduction) procedure, which involves minimally reducing the enamel between the teeth.
After the active phase is complete, a stabilization phase with retainers is essential to ensure that the achieved results are maintained in the long term. We offer both fixed retainers (thin wires on the inside of the teeth) and removable retainers. Regular check-ups ensure that your teeth remain in the correct position.

With consistent follow-up treatment with retainers, the results of orthodontic treatment can last a lifetime. It is important to wear the retainers regularly. Without sufficient retention, there is a risk that the teeth will move back toward their original position.
In mild to moderate cases with invisible braces, treatment can be completed in as little as 6-12 months. More complex cases usually require 18-24 months. In our practice, we use efficient treatment methods to keep the duration of therapy as short as possible.
Orthodontic treatment is usually painless. Our patients find aligner systems particularly comfortable. After each change of aligners or after adjustments to fixed brackets, there may be a feeling of pressure for a few days, but this is usually mild and can be treated well with over-the-counter painkillers.
When performed professionally, the risks of orthodontic treatment are minimal. Possible risks include slight root resorption (shortening of the tooth roots) and an increased risk of caries if oral hygiene is inadequate during treatment with fixed appliances. We minimize these risks through regular check-ups.
With invisible braces for adults, there are hardly any restrictions in everyday life. You can remove the aligners for eating and drinking. With fixed brackets, very hard and sticky foods should be avoided. Sports can be played without restriction in all cases, although we recommend wearing a Mouthguard for contact sports.
Aligners should be cleaned with lukewarm water and a soft toothbrush. You should brush your teeth after every meal before putting the aligners back in. For fixed brackets, we recommend special interdental brushes and, if necessary, an electric toothbrush.
